I just bought a 2003 300M Special from a local dealer and was investigating as to why I couldn't get any tire pressure readings. Come to finally notice that I have the original full size 18" spare in the trunk and 16" Concorde wheels on the car (with no sensors)! Not only am I pissed, but I am also wondering how much does this affect everything else, from the speedo to the EVIC info? Is it still safe to drive it with smaller wheels on it?

Except for this, the car is in excellent condition and I paid only $11k for it. Although I really don't wanna give up the car, I WILL be calling the dealer about this tomorrow. Guess now I know why it was a good deal. Any suggestions on any other courses of action I can take on this?

I think you got screwed, too. The 16' wheels are safe as long as they are a good tire and you don't drive at excessive speeds. Yes, your evic info and speedo will be off. Check out miata.net/garage/tirecalc.html.

Thanks for the URLs, tinman. Good ones to have. Turns out I'm getting one extra revolution per mile with the Goodyears that were put on it for a 0.2% difference.

Of course, the dealer says "That's how the car was when we got it, sorry". So, now I'm shopping around for some 18's to put on it. Found one place where I can get 4 OEM ones to match the spare for $800. Have a friend that says he can get me a deal on some tires. Can hopefully sell the Concord wheels to recoup some of it. Any leads on where to get the tire pressure sensors? Can't seem to find a source online. Dealer has them for $60 each and I need 4. Is that about what I can expect to pay for them if I go anywhere else?
